Each week, we will meet for 90 minutes and focus on a particular element of the craft. I will give a teaching and then you will write following prompts designed to support you in the exploration of that element. You will be given assignments to do on your own or with a cohort during the week to continue the practice.

During our 8-week session, we will focus on the following:

Week 1: The Heart—identifying the story you want to tell
Week 2: Character Development—Who is telling the story and who else is in the story
Week 3: Dialog—How to write compelling dialog that moves the story along
Week 4: Going Deep, Deeper—How to find the deeper layers of the story that might not be evident at first glance
Week 5: Transformation—What transformation do you or others experience and why this is important
Week 6: Point of View—When to be intimate, when more panoramic
Week 7: Finding the Scenes—Which scenes tell the story best
Week 8: Structure—Stringing it all together

What is so remarkable about writing is that in following the needs of the art form, one is led down a path of self-discovery. Not only do we see ourselves more clearly, we also see others from a more empathetic point-of-view. In this way, the act of writing changes our lives in the best of ways: creating insight and generating compassion.
